Output 185759577603bfa21d98afc6669dd2a1b15f98a51290a4d2a3e02aa036522884:8

value
84055
script pubkey
OP_0 OP_PUSHBYTES_20 073f610b6d4abc9a299ec5ea7bd487a2920119f4
address
bc1qqulkzzmdf27f52v7ch48h4y852fqzx05uxsezs
transaction
185759577603bfa21d98afc6669dd2a1b15f98a51290a4d2a3e02aa036522884
spent
true